For the 2025 school year, there are 4 public preschools serving 661 students in 62864, IL.
The top ranked public preschools in 62864, IL are Summersville Grade School and Bethel Grade School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public preschools in zipcode 62864 have an average math proficiency score of 31% (versus the Illinois public pre school average of 22%), and reading proficiency score of 46% (versus the 25% statewide average). Pre schools in 62864, IL have an average ranking of 8/10, which is in the top 30% of Illinois public pre schools.
Minority enrollment is 27% of the student body (majority Black), which is less than the Illinois public preschool average of 58% (majority Hispanic).
